[0001] This utility model relates to the field of pit mud sampling devices, and in particular to a precise sampling device for strong-aroma pit mud. Background Technology
[0002] In the traditional strong-aroma baijiu brewing process, the quality of the cellar mud is crucial to the formation of the liquor's flavor. The microbial community and physicochemical properties of the cellar mud often exhibit vertical stratification and regional distribution characteristics. Therefore, it is necessary to accurately obtain cellar mud samples at specific depths and angles for analysis.
[0003] However, existing pit mud sampling devices generally suffer from problems such as inaccurate sampling depth control, inability to achieve precise stratification, and difficulty in controlling the sampling angle, resulting in insufficient sample representativeness. Conventional sampling tools mostly use simple tubular structures, rely on manual experience to judge the sampling depth, and lack precise scale markings and depth locking mechanisms, which can easily lead to sampling that is too deep or too shallow, affecting the accuracy of the test data.
[0004] To address the aforementioned issues, this patent proposes a cellar mud sampling device capable of precise sampling at a fixed depth and angle, and with stratified extraction capabilities, in order to meet the refined requirements of modern brewing processes for cellar mud analysis. [0013] Beneficial effects:
[0014] 1. The sampling tube of this utility model is connected to a cutting head at the lower end and an upper cover with a depth adjustment slide rod at the upper end. A depth control piston is set at the lower end of the depth adjustment slide rod. The depth control piston is used to limit the cutting depth by sliding in the sampling tube. With the depth control accuracy and depth limit bolt on the depth adjustment slide rod, the precise depth sampling of pit mud can be achieved, ensuring that the sampling depth is controllable and the data is quantifiable.
[0015] 2. This utility model sets a limiting slip ring on the outside of the sampling tube, and forms an angle adjustment structure through the angle adjustment frame, the angle adjustment shaft and the limiting base plate, so that the sampling tube can cut into the pit mud at different angles. At the same time, it is used in conjunction with the pointer turntable, the angle adjustment scale and the limiting bolt to lock the angle, so as to achieve accurate sampling from multiple angles and improve the sample diversity.
[0016] 3. This utility model adjusts the position of the depth control piston by adjusting the depth slide bar, and combines the depth control accuracy to achieve precise layered extraction of pit mud samples. Through the coordinated work of the depth adjustment handle, depth limiting bolt and depth control accuracy, the operator can intuitively and accurately control the sampling depth and layer thickness, reduce human error and improve the scientificity and repeatability of sampling.
[0017] 4. After sampling is completed, the sampling spring pushes the upper cover to automatically rebound, allowing the sampling cylinder to be pulled out of the pit mud, simplifying the operation process and improving sampling efficiency. A rubber sealing ring is set between the depth control piston and the sampling cylinder to ensure sample leakage during the sampling process, guaranteeing the integrity and accuracy of the sampling. [0027] To achieve the above-mentioned utility model objectives, such as Figures 1-5As shown, this utility model provides a precise sampling device for strong-aroma cellar mud, including a sampling cylinder 1, a cutting head 2 connected to the lower end of the sampling cylinder 1, an upper cover 3 connected to the upper end of the sampling cylinder 1, a depth adjustment slide rod 4 penetrating vertically through the center of the upper cover 3, and the lower end of the depth adjustment slide rod 4 extending into the interior of the sampling cylinder 1, a depth control piston 5 connected to the lower end of the depth adjustment slide rod 4, the depth control piston 5 being slidably connected inside the sampling cylinder 1, and a rubber sealing ring provided between the piston 5 and the sampling cylinder 1, a depth control mark 6 being provided on the outer wall of the depth adjustment slide rod 4, and a depth adjustment handle 7 connected to the upper end of the depth adjustment slide rod 4, and the depth adjustment handle 7 being positioned... A depth limiting bolt 8 is threadedly connected to the center of the front end of the upper cover 3 on the outside of the upper cover 3. The rear end of the depth limiting bolt 8 extends to the outer wall of the front end of the depth adjusting slide bar 4 and fits tightly with the outer wall of the depth adjusting slide bar 4. During the sampling of the pit mud, the pit mud can be sampled at a fixed depth through the sampling tube 1. The sampling tube 1 cuts into the pit mud through the cutting head 2, and the depth of cutting is limited by the position of the depth controlling piston 5 inside the sampling tube 1, so that the pit mud enters the sampling tube 1 inside the depth controlling piston 5. The pit mud is then brought out by pulling out the sampling tube 1, thereby sampling the pit mud at a fixed depth.
[0028] The position of the depth control piston 5 inside the sampling cylinder 1 can be adjusted by sliding the depth adjustment slide rod 4 up and down inside the upper cover 3. By pulling the depth adjustment handle 7 up and down, the depth adjustment slide rod 4 is pulled up and down, and the depth control piston 5 is moved up and down inside the sampling cylinder 1, thereby adjusting the position of the depth control piston 5 inside the sampling cylinder 1, and thus adjusting the depth of the cutting head 2 into the pit mud. The depth adjustment slide rod 4 can precisely adjust the position of the depth control piston 5 by the value exposed by the depth control depth 6 on the outer wall, and can be fixed by the depth limiting bolt 8. After the depth adjustment slide rod 4 is fixed to the upper cover 3 by the depth limiting bolt 8, the depth adjustment handle 7 is pressed down. The depth adjustment handle 7 drives the upper cover 3 to move downward through the upper cover 3, and the upper cover 3 drives the sampling cylinder 1 and the cutting head 2 to cut into the pit mud.
[0029] Preferably, a limiting slip ring 9 is sleeved on the outside of the sampling cylinder 1 and slidably connected inside the limiting slip ring 9. The limiting slip ring 9 is located between the cutting head 2 and the upper cover 3. Angle adjustment brackets 10 are connected to both ends of the limiting slip ring 9. The two angle adjustment brackets 10 are rotatably connected to connecting seats 11 through angle adjustment shafts on the lower side of one end of the limiting slip ring 9. The two angle adjustment shafts extend in opposite directions to the outside of the two connecting seats 11 away from the angle adjustment brackets 10. The lower ends of the two connecting seats 11 are connected to a limiting angle base plate 12. A cutting groove 13 is opened at the center of the limiting angle base plate 12, and the cutting groove 13 is located at the cutting head 2. Directly below the infeeder 2, during the process of inserting the infeeder 2 into the pit mud, the sampling cylinder 1 and the infeeder 2 can be restricted in their position relative to the two angle-adjusting rotating frames 10 by the limiting slip ring 9, and the angle between the two angle-adjusting rotating frames 10 and the limiting angle base plate 12 can be adjusted by rotating the two angle-adjusting rotating frames 10 between the two connecting rotating seats 11. At this time, the limiting angle base plate 12 is attached to the upper end of the pit mud, and the depth adjustment handle 7 is pressed down, so that the sampling cylinder 1 slides downward inside the limiting slip ring 9, and drives the infeeder 2 to pass through the cutting groove 13 and cut into the pit mud, thereby adjusting the sampling angle of the pit mud and ensuring the diversity of pit mud sampling.
[0030] Preferably, each of the two angle-adjusting shafts is connected to a pointer dial 14 at the end away from the angle-adjusting frame 10. The pointer dial 14 is attached to the outer wall of the connecting base 11 at the end away from the angle-adjusting frame 10. An angle-adjusting pointer 15 is provided on the upper side of the pointer dial 14 at the end away from the connecting base 11. An angle-adjusting scale 16 is provided on the upper side of the connecting base 11 at the end near the pointer dial 14. A limiting bolt 17 is threadedly connected to the center of the upper end of the connecting base 11. The lower end of the limiting bolt 17 extends to the outer wall of the upper end of the angle-adjusting shaft and fits tightly against the outer wall of the angle-adjusting shaft. A sampling spring 1 is provided between the upper cover 3 and the limiting slip ring 9. 8. The sampling spring 18 is sleeved on the outside of the sampling cylinder 1. During the adjustment of the sampling angle, the angle adjustment frame 10 drives the pointer dial 14 to rotate through the adjustment shaft, and drives the angle adjustment pointer 15 to rotate through the pointer dial 14. At this time, the angle adjustment pointer 15 can accurately adjust the angle between the angle adjustment frame 10 and the angle limiting base plate 12 by pointing to the value of the angle adjustment scale 16, so that the sampling angle of the pit mud can be accurately controlled, and the sampling angle can be fixed by the tight fit between the angle limiting bolt 17 and the angle adjustment shaft, so that the pit mud can be sampled at a specific angle, which is more representative.
[0031] In addition, after the sampling tube 1 and the cutting head 2 cut into the pit mud, the pressure on the depth adjustment handle 7 is released. The upper cover 3 moves upward under the action of the sampling spring 18, and pulls the sampling tube 1 and the cutting head 2 out of the pit mud to complete the sampling. When taking out the pit mud sample from the sampling tube 1, the pit mud at different depths needs to be analyzed in layers. At this time, the depth limiting bolt 8 is loosened so that the depth adjustment slide rod 4 can slide inside the upper cover 3. The depth adjustment slide rod 4 controls the layer thickness precisely by controlling the depth 6 to shrink to the value inside the upper cover 3, so as to ensure the accurate layering of the pit mud.
